Podcast transcript (pdf) Today’s discussion features two couples of mixed marriages – that is, one Indigenous and one non-Indigenous partner. We’ll be exploring what we can learn about dynamic indigenous cultures today, and the personal growth of individuals and couples, through looking at the experiences of off-reservation mixed marriages. Perhaps what we're going to deal with today is a little bit counterintuitive, because there's a prevailing cultural notion that when people marry outside of their ethnic group, or their religious group, that some kind of dilution of culture - some kind of loss of culture - is a great risk. I think what we're going to find today is that that isn't always the case. And sometimes it's the opposite.
